About the Philips V900: A Versatile Device Released in 2010

In February of 2010, Philips announced their new device – the V900. It was released a month later in March of the same year. The V900 quickly gained popularity due to its impressive features and sleek design. Let's take a closer look at this versatile device and all that it had to offer.

The Design and Display of the V900

The V900 is a lightweight device, weighing only 153.5g with dimensions of 115 x 62.4 x 13.2mm. The SIM card used in the device is a Mini-SIM. It boasted a 3.5 inch TFT screen with 256K colors and a resolution of 480 x 800 pixels, giving it a pixel density of 267 ppi. With its 48.6% screen-to-body ratio, the display was perfect for watching videos or browsing the internet.

The Operating System and Storage

The V900 ran on an Android-based operating system called OPhone OS. It came with 40MB of inbuilt storage and a microSDHC slot for external storage. This allowed users to store all of their favorite apps, photos, and music without having to worry about running out of space.

The Cameras and Sound Quality

The V900 featured a single 3.15 MP camera, equipped with autofocus. It also had a video recording capability of 320p. Although the front camera was missing, it did not impact the overall experience as the device was released at a time when front cameras were not as common. Additionally, the V900 came with a loudspeaker and a 3.5 mm jack, providing crisp sound quality for music and calls.

The Connectivity of the V900

The V900 had a variety of connectivity options, making it a user-friendly device. It had Wi-Fi capabilities (802.11 b/g), Bluetooth 2.0 with A2DP, and GPS with A-GPS. It also had a miniUSB 2.0 port for easy data transfer.

Other Features and Price

The V900 came in one color – black. It was priced at about 470 EUR, making it an affordable option for those looking to upgrade their phone. It also had additional features such as an MP3/WAV/AAC+ player, MP4/H.264 player, organizer, voice memo, and predictive text input.
